Student Led Transition Program
The South Alternative Learning Center engages all students through our Peer Counseling program to support all students in positive decision making, goal setting and planning, and positive peer relationships. Student leaders are identified and connected with new, incoming students to ensure a smooth and successful transition under the direct supervision of a certified teacher.
BPS and the SALC are committed to ensuring a peer-led, safe, and positive transition for students from military families into our schools. For support, please contact the Military Point of Contact listed at the top of this webpage.
